The right mindset before you begin

  • This is a craft, not a lottery ticket. Consistency beats intensity. A little every day compounds.
  • Losses are tuition, not failure. Every trader loses. The skill is losing small and surviving to trade again.
  • Protect your capital first. Rule one is don't blow up. Profits are what's left after you've managed risk.
  • Trust the process over the outcome. You can do everything right and still lose a trade. Judge yourself on discipline, not on any single result.
